The combination of SketchUp 2017 and V-Ray 3.4 represented a major turning point for architectural visualization, introducing a modernized interface and a more streamlined workflow. This update moved away from the complex, multi-window setups of older versions in favor of a unified Asset Editor. Key Features of V-Ray 3.4 for SketchUp 2017

Camera EV values: Aim for 12–13 for outdoor shots and 8–11 for interiors for proper exposure.
